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

highlight add-ons for Cockpit #348

Closed
garrett opened this issue Sep 30, 2020 · 7 comments · Fixed by #404
Closed

highlight add-ons for Cockpit #348

garrett opened this issue Sep 30, 2020 · 7 comments · Fixed by #404

Comments

@garrett
Copy link
Member

garrett commented Sep 30, 2020

I don't think the website talks about https://github.com/Scribery/cockpit-session-recording, for example. We probably want to highlight Cockpit Podman a bit more as well.

Additionally, if we had instructions on how to add these in the various distros (such as adding cockpit-session-recording on Fedora), that would be fantastic.

@garrett
Copy link
Member Author

garrett commented Oct 13, 2020

1st party add-ons

Add-ons built from the Cockpit source:

  • cockpit-selinux
  • cockpit-storaged
  • cockpit-bridge
  • cockpit-kdump
  • cockpit-networkmanager
  • cockpit-packagekit
  • cockpit-pcp
  • cockpit-selinux
  • cockpit-sosreport

Add-ons externally maintained by the Cockpit & Front Door teams:

2rd-party add-ons

Add-ons from other teams in Red Hat:

Add-ons that are RHEL specific:

@Protektor-Desura
Copy link

Here is a plugin for ZFS management
https://github.com/optimans/cockpit-zfs-manager

@Protektor-Desura
Copy link

Anyone aware of a cockpit plugin for:

MergerFS https://github.com/trapexit/mergerfs
SnapRAID https://github.com/amadvance/snapraid/
https://www.snapraid.it/

@garrett
Copy link
Member Author

garrett commented Apr 21, 2021

On the page, for every add-on, it should show:

  • Title
  • Homepage
  • Link to issues
  • Distros where it's included by default (as a package)
  • Installation method? (applications page vs. package)
  • Summary
  • Version?
  • In development vs. production?
  • Official vs. third party

Then there should be groups:

  1. Official Cockpit-maintained add-ons first
  2. Third-party production-ready ones
  3. In-development, not ready for use yet (preview add-ons)

@garrett
Copy link
Member Author

garrett commented Apr 22, 2021

@Protektor-Desura: I do see a project for cockpit-zfs-manager, but I don't see where there might be anything for Cockpit for MergerFS or SnapRAID.

The MergerFS wiki page @ https://github.com/trapexit/mergerfs/wiki/Tutorials,-Articles,-Videos,-Podcasts has a link to https://www.youtube.com/watch?v=aLyTWdzDiCg, which is a video from 2017 (so a lot of stuff has changed).

@garrett
Copy link
Member Author

garrett commented Apr 22, 2021

Meanwhile, I'm going through everything on this page and adding it as a structured data set in YAML for the website. I intend on generating a page for the website from this data. I intend on posting a PR soon.

garrett added a commit to garrett/cockpit-project.github.io that referenced this issue Apr 22, 2021
Includes links to the page as well.

Fixes cockpit-project#348.
garrett added a commit to garrett/cockpit-project.github.io that referenced this issue Apr 22, 2021
Includes links to the page as well.

Fixes cockpit-project#348.
garrett added a commit to garrett/cockpit-project.github.io that referenced this issue Apr 22, 2021
Includes links to the page as well.

Fixes cockpit-project#348.
@Protektor-Desura
Copy link

Protektor-Desura commented Apr 22, 2021

@garrett

The MergerFS wiki page @ https://github.com/trapexit/mergerfs/wiki/Tutorials,-Articles,-Videos,-Podcasts has a link to https://www.youtube.com/watch?v=aLyTWdzDiCg, which is a video from 2017 (so a lot of stuff has changed).

I watched the video and saw him talking about Cockpit but I didn't see anything mentioned about MergerFS or SnapRAID let alone a plugin for them for Cockpit. The video was basically an overview of cockpit for that version at the time.

garrett added a commit to garrett/cockpit-project.github.io that referenced this issue Apr 26, 2021
Includes links to the page as well.

Fixes cockpit-project#348.
garrett added a commit to garrett/cockpit-project.github.io that referenced this issue Apr 26, 2021
Includes links to the page as well.

Fixes cockpit-project#348.
garrett added a commit to garrett/cockpit-project.github.io that referenced this issue Apr 27, 2021
Includes links to the page as well.

Fixes cockpit-project#348.
garrett added a commit that referenced this issue Apr 27, 2021
Includes links to the page as well.

Fixes #348.
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

Successfully merging a pull request may close this issue.

2 participants